这是一个市场上最好的javascript后端库列表,甚至我会推荐你把它收藏起来,以便将来参考,就像我为自己做的那样 ?。1. Express   快速,简单,极简的Node Web框架。 2. Socket.io   Socket.IO支持基于事件的实时双向通信 3. Body-parser   Node.js bod
文章目录一. 功能效果二. 功能思路三. 代码3.1 前端部分代码3.2 web层代码 : routeServlet 继承 baseServlet3.3 service层代码 : routeServiceImpl 实现 routeService接口3.4 dao层代码 : routeDaoImpl 实现 routeDao接口3.5 其他代码3.5.1 PageUtil - 调用静态方法计算Pag
转载 2023-07-07 01:19:52
108阅读
执行npm install后,如果打包成功,会在当前目录下生成一个node_modules的文件夹,里面存放着我们所需的依赖包。 当需要引用时,例如: nodejs会首先在当前目录下查找是否存在node_modules文件夹,存在的话会在node_modules文件夹下继续查找math包,如果存在m
转载 2019-06-09 13:41:00
236阅读
2评论
1,服务端JavaScriptJavaScript是一门“完整”的语言: 它可以使用在不同的上下文中,其能力与其他同类语言相比有过之而无不及。 Node.js事实上就是另外一种上下文,它允许在后端(脱离浏览器环境)运行JavaScript代码。 Node.js事实上既是一个运行时环境,同时又是一个库。2,Hello World创建server.jsvar http = require("http"
# MySQL搜索数据功能概述 在现代应用中,搜索功能是关键组件之一,它能够帮助用户快速地找到所需的信息。在本篇文章中,我们将探讨如何在MySQL数据库中实现搜索功能,并提供一些代码示例帮助您理解。 ## 1. MySQL搜索基础 MySQL是一个开源的关系数据库管理系统,支持多种数据类型和复杂的查询操作。针对搜索需求,我们通常会使用SQL查询语句来从表中提取所需的数据。 ### 1.1.
原创 2024-09-11 06:16:55
130阅读
Python 届的 GUI 有很多库,像鼎鼎大名的 Tkinter、PyGUI 等,但问题是他们生成的 GUI 都不够好看,有种上世纪应用程序的风格,完全不像是互联网时代的产品。今天给大家推荐一个超级棒的工具 Electron,只需要懂一些简单的 html、css 和 js 知识就能写出跨平台的,互联网风格的应用。大名鼎鼎的 Visual Studio Code 就是使用 Electron 来编写
转载 2024-04-10 19:02:01
48阅读
这里仅针对通用搜索框的常见测试点进行总结分享,实际工作中需结合搜索功能的背景业务需求及其他依赖条件来综合设计测试点。一、功能实现部分(1)如果支持模糊查询,搜索名称中任意一个字符是否能搜索到对于支持模糊查询的搜索框,测试搜索名称中的任意字符是否能够搜索到。例如,在一个商品列表的搜索框中,当输入”HUAWEI”时,查询出的结果应该包括“华为”,“HUAWEI Watch”等。如果没有搜索到,说明搜索
参考资料:https://www.freesion.com/article/8399663484/https://cloud.tencent.com/developer/article/1529654https://zhuyc.vip/archives/2020043013343102208elasticsearchResttemplate注入:https://www.jianshu.com/p/
form 表单提交:                <p>搜索专业人员</p>   <form action="{$CATEGORYS[13][url]}" method="post">       <input type="text" name="q" id="q" placeholder=&quo
原创 2022-08-23 06:59:09
133阅读
# 使用 Axios 实现搜索功能入门指南 在前端开发中,使用 Axios 进行 API 请求非常普遍,特别是实现搜索功能。本文将通过详细的步骤指导您如何使用 Axios 创建一个简单的搜索功能。 ## 整体流程 以下是实现搜索功能的整体步骤: | 步骤 | 描述 | |------|----------------------------
原创 2024-10-27 06:08:09
103阅读
# Android Studio搜索功能 Android Studio是一款由Google开发的Android应用开发集成开发环境(IDE),它为Android开发者提供了丰富的工具和功能来简化开发过程。其中一个非常有用的功能就是搜索功能,它可以帮助开发者快速定位和查找代码、资源文件等。本文将介绍Android Studio的搜索功能,并提供一些代码示例来演示如何使用。 ## 搜索功能的基本用
原创 2023-12-26 06:07:14
323阅读
张量形状的重塑首先阐述一下什么是 “视图”:视图是数据的一个别称或引用,通过该别称或引用便可访问、操作原有数据,原有数据不会产生拷贝。如果我们对视图进行修改,它会影响到原始数据,因为物理内存在同一位置,这样避免了重新创建张量的高内存开销。对张量的大部分操作就是视图操作。与视图相对应的概念就是 “副本”:副本是一个数据的完整的拷贝,如果我们对副本进行修改,它不会影响到原始数据,因为物理内存不在同一位
总结之所以放前面是因为正文部分写的比较乱。做这个功能让我想起刚毕业的一次面试问题,问题是“如何实现搜索功能”,当时的回答大概是根据关键字遍历数据集然后提取匹配到记录等等,反正现在想来回答是很水的。说这个的重点不是面试,而是想说说自己心态的改变。毕业找工作:工作经验?不存在的。道理我都懂,给我点时间我什么都能做。现在:工作经验?存在的。没实际的写过一些东西,不踩过一些坑,怎么可能成长起来。比如开发过
# Java中的搜索功能实现 在软件开发中,搜索功能是最常见的需求之一,无论是在Web应用、桌面应用还是移动应用中,搜索功能都扮演着至关重要的角色。本文将介绍如何在Java中实现一个基本的搜索功能,并通过代码示例、类图和状态图来详细说明。 ## 搜索功能的基本概念 搜索功能通常包括以下几个步骤: 1. 用户输入搜索关键词。 2. 系统根据关键词在数据源中查找匹配项。 3. 将搜索结果展示给用
原创 2024-07-15 20:43:17
69阅读
# Node.js与MySQL的时间范围模糊搜索实现 ## 一、引言 在许多应用程序中,模糊搜索是一个常见的需求。特别是在处理时间数据时,例如查找某个时间范围内的记录,可以有效提升用户体验。本文将以Node.js和MySQL作为背景,讲解如何实现时间范围的模糊搜索。 ## 二、整体流程 在实现“Node.js与MySQL时间范围模糊搜索”之前,我们需要明确一下整个项目流程。以下是相关步骤的
原创 10月前
79阅读
在很多需要搜索的网站, 都会有一个自动完成的搜索框. 方便用户查找他们想要的搜索词. 帮助用户快速找到自己想要的结果. 这种方式是比较友好的. 所以是比较提倡使用的.我们这次就来实现这一效果. 我们通过这篇文章来进行讲解. 首先我们来完成界面的设计布局. 界面的HTML中当然少不了的是一个搜索框, 第二个就是搜索的点击按钮.下面是用来存储提示的一个列表。 <div class="
转载 2024-05-29 08:56:40
358阅读
1.什么是推荐引擎?推荐引擎就是一个最可能为用户做出下一个选择的应用或微服务.推荐内容包括如用户最想听的下一首歌,他们最想看的下一场电影或者他们预定某服务后下一步可能做出的选择行为.在系统层面,推荐引擎会匹配用户最可能感兴趣的物品.通过推送相关的个性化推荐给用户,应用会引导用户购买相关物品,提升他们在网站或APP上的停留时间或者点击想看的广告-最终帮助对收入,使用率的最大化.一个有效的推荐引擎需要
转载 2023-09-08 23:14:16
61阅读
# Java实现搜索搜索功能 ## 1. 整体流程 首先,让我们来看一下实现搜索搜索功能的整体流程。下面是一个流程图,展示了从用户输入关键字到搜索结果展示的步骤: ```mermaid flowchart TD A(用户输入关键字) --> B(获取关键字) B --> C(构建搜索请求) C --> D(发送搜索请求) D --> E(解析搜索结果)
原创 2023-09-19 19:35:23
204阅读
      我刚接触到模糊查询的时候,是在第一次面试的时候,考官让我们写个模糊查询的例子,当时我很蒙圈,不了解这是什么,等面试之后,自己就查了查,也动手实践了一下。下面我想把我对模糊查询的认识告诉给大家。首先      模糊查询即模糊检索,是指搜索系统自动按照用户输入关键词的同义
问题检索包含特定单词,但不包含其他特定单词的文本。约定: 检索语句中,+表示为前一个字的同义词,-表示检索结果中不得包含该词。如:“你+您-可-以搜索”,表示检索包含“你”(“您”)、“搜”、“索”,且不包含“可”、“以”的所有文本。思路1、建立反向索引(类似于书本末尾的索引),即从每个被索引的文档中抽取部分单词,并为每个单词创建一个集合set(key=idx:单词),用来记录单词所包括含于的文
转载 2023-08-15 06:51:51
112阅读
  • 1
  • 2
  • 3
  • 4
  • 5